One significant innovation is the adoption of variable temperature control. Traditional sandwich grills often struggled with maintaining consistent heat, leading to unevenly cooked sandwiches. Modern models, however, come with precise temperature regulation, ensuring that every slice of bread is toasted to perfection. This technological leap has also minimized the risk of burning or undercooking, making for a more enjoyable dining experience.

Another area of innovation lies in the design of the grill plates. The evolution from flat, solid surfaces to textured and non-stick coatings has transformed the way sandwiches are grilled. Textured surfaces provide better grip and help in achieving that sought-after grill mark, while non-stick coatings make for easier cleanup and reduced chances of food sticking to the plates.

Energy efficiency has become a crucial factor in the design of modern sandwich grills. Innovators have focused on reducing energy consumption without compromising on performance. This has been achieved through the use of advanced heating elements and improved insulation, resulting in appliances that are both eco-friendly and cost-effective.

One of the key benefits of continuous operation is the reduction in downtime. Traditional sandwich grills often require cooling periods between batches, which can lead to idle time and lost productivity. Continuous operation grills eliminate this downtime by allowing for an unbroken production line. This means that as one batch finishes, the grill is immediately ready to start cooking the next, minimizing any potential lulls in the workflow.

Energy efficiency is another critical aspect of continuous operation. These grills are engineered to maintain optimal cooking temperatures with minimal energy consumption. By doing so, they not only save on operational costs but also reduce the environmental impact. The precise control over heat distribution ensures that the energy used is focused on cooking, rather than wasted on unnecessary heating or cooling.

Maintenance and RepairWith around-the-clock operation, the risk of equipment failure is heightened. Preventive maintenance is key to minimizing downtime. Many plants are now investing in predictive maintenance technologies. These technologies use sensors and data analytics to identify potential issues before they lead to breakdowns, allowing for timely repairs and reducing the impact on production schedules.
